Questions about Wendy

  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    A Border Collie and Siberian Husky mix thrives in a home with plenty of space to play and opportunities for exercise. This breed does well in active households that can meet their energetic needs.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    This mix benefits from a large yard or access to open outdoor spaces. Daily exercise and play in secure areas are important to keep them mentally and physically stimulated.

  •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?

    This breed generally does well with children, especially active ones who are eager to engage with a playful and affectionate companion. Early socialization ensures positive interactions.
